I have been using this ball chair since purchasing it in Feb, 2009. The ball sites in a metal ring with 4 caster posts and a fitting for the seat back welded to it. The casters insert into the posts and has 4 holes for adjusting the seat height by about 2 inches. The back rest attaches to the fitting on the bottom ring using two curved metal pieces. The ball chair works as described - I use it all day and it promotes good upright posture. The welds that hold the back on broke in June after 4 months of use. Since I weigh 170 lbs this seems more like a manufacturing defect than a misuse of the chair issue. I have sent the company several emails requesting a replacement part but have never received a reply. So I like the concept of the ball chair but would buy one that was better constructed.

It's a great office chair. Follow the inflationn instructions to the letter. When you first get the chair it may seem the the ball is too small. You have to fill the ball partially and let it sit over night. The ball will be able to be inflated to the full size the next day. It's comfortable, holds your body in the correct alignment, and a conversation piece. I love it.
